Chesterton Close is in Greenford and in Ealing district. UB6 9TE is located in the Greenford Broadway elect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Ealing North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Chesterton Close was 44.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 39.2% lower than the Greenford Broadway average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Chesterton Close has the 9th lowest crime rate of 48 local areas in Greenford Broadway and the 218th lowest crime rate of 964 local areas in Ealing .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 29.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-62.2%.
